Трудности - программирование - Большая Энциклопедия Нефти и Газа, статья, страница 2
Если ты споришь с идиотом, вероятно тоже самое делает и он. Законы Мерфи (еще...)

Трудности - программирование

Cтраница 2


Зародившись около 20 лет назад, техника управления технологическими процессами, опирающаяся на электронные вычислительные машины ( ЭВМ), прошла ряд этапов развития и совершенствования. Основные идеи управления технологическими процессами с применением ЭВМ были выработаны на сравнительно ранних стадиях развития автоматизированных систем управления ( АСУ), однако их реализация наталкивалась на трудности, связанные с недостатками вычислительной аппаратуры и других технических средств, а также на трудности программирования и организации вычислительного процесса в управляющих ЭВМ.  [16]

Эта методика называется структурировашгоо программирование. Даже только в литературе на русском языке можно найти термины структурное, систематическое, детализирующее, нисходящее программирование, которые обозначают примерно одно и то же. Схему структурированного программирования мы объясним в следующем параграфе, а пока скажем лишь, какие трудности программирования пытается преодолеть эта методика.  [17]

Или, скажем, разрабатывается система для международной страховой компании. Если работник занимает должность директора регионального отделения, он имеет право на получение 236 % суммы комиссионных, выплаченных его подчиненным. Расчеты становятся более интересными, если статус руководителя постоянно меняется. Догадливый программист обратится к этой фирме с просьбой развернуть свою деятельность повсюду, но не все трудности программирования разрешаются таким прямолинейным путем. Итак, нужны программы, позволяющие решать такие задачи. Это означает, что нужны некие языки программирования. Термин язык запросов является общим для таких языков.  [18]

Несмотря на трудности неавтоматического программирования состав фонда ежегодно возрастал в среднем на 25 тыс. команд.  [19]

Прямые методы позволяют получить решение системы после выполнения конечного числа действий. Основной недостаток этих методов - очень большой объем вычислительной работы, который приходится выполнять даже при решении простых задач. Они также требуют большого объема памяти ЭВМ. Этот прием позволяет в ряде случаев существенно снизить необходимый объем вычислений. Однако при этом существенно возрастают трудности программирования алгоритмов. Поэтому прямые методы в практике моделирования процесса разработки используются довольно редко.  [20]

Поэтому почти всегда наблюдается тенденция имитировать избыточное число деталей. Во избежание такого положения следует строить модель, ориентированную на решение вопросов, на которые требуется найти ответы, а не имитировать реальную систему во всех подробностях. Закон Парето гласит, что в каждой группе или совокупности существует жизненно важное меньшинство и тривиальное большинство. Ничего действительно важного не происходит, пока не затронуто жизненно важное меньшинство. Системные аналитики слишком часто стремились перенести все усугубленные деталями сложности реальных ситуаций в модель, надеясь, что ЭВМ решит их проблемы. Такой подход неудовлетворителен не только потому, что возрастают трудности программирования модели и стоимость удлиняющихся экспериментальных прогонов, но и потому, что действительно важные аспекты и взаимосвязи могут потонуть в массе тривиальных деталей. Вот почему модель должна отображать только те аспекты системы, которые соответствуют задачам исследования.  [21]



Страницы:      1    2